§ 2354 — Licensure requirement of dead domestic animal disposal businesses

Any person who purchases or receives for disposal a dead domestic animal, domestic animal part or potentially infectious animal waste shall be deemed to be in the business of dead domestic animal disposal and shall be licensed by the department to engage in and conduct such activity.
